SEC Delays Bitcoin ETF Proposals From Blackrock, Valkyrie
Portfolio Pulse from Benzinga Neuro
The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C) has postponed decisions on several Bitcoin ETF proposals, including those from BlackRock and Valkyrie. This follows previous delays for Ark 21Shares and GlobalX until January 2023. Despite these delays, the SEC is pushing forward with Ethereum futures ETFs. Valkyrie Investments recently became the first of nine ETF issuers to secure SEC approval for an ETF that allows investors to speculate on the future price of Ethereum.
